Navionics® NavPlanner2 is an atlas of US coastal waters, navigable waterways, and over 12,000 inland lakes for the home computer for map viewing, searching, printing, waypoint planning, and GPS data managing.
This software includes Navionics Gold US marine charts and HotMaps Premium US lake maps for use on your PC*. 


Navionics HotMaps Explorer
Plan your entire trip with detailed navigation and fishing maps including bottom contours, structures, drop-offs, marinas, boat ramps, fishery information, and more.
Locate ports with Go-to-port; measure distance and bearing or print paper copies to take with you.
With Navionics NavPlanner2, green water anglers can maximize their time on the water by unlocking a lake’s secrets prior to leaving for their trip while coastal cruisers can quickly and easily plan their trip and upload to their chart plotter or print a paper copy to take with them.

    F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
    What coastal areas are included?
    All U.S. coastal waters are built into the software. This includes Hawaii and Alaska. BONUS: Also includes Northern Bahamas.
    (Existing NavPlanner2 users may update their coastal charts to 2011 content for free.)
    Which Inland waters are covered?
    Includes US portions only of the Great Lakes, Lake Champlain, Finger Lakes, Ohio River, Cumberland River, Kanawha River, Allegheny River, Green River, Illinois River, Missouri River, Tennessee River, Mississippi River, Arkansas River, and the Tennessee-Tombigbee Waterway
    . (Existing NavPlanner2 users may update their inland charts to 2011 content for free.)
    Which freshwater lakes are included?


  • Over 12,000 freshwater (inland) lakes within the United States. Complete lake list.
    (Existing NavPlanner2 users may update their lake maps to 2011 content for free.)
    Which High-Defintion Lakes are included?
    All of the exclusive Navionics High Definition lakes, with one-foot contour intervals, available for the United States in the 2010 Navionics Hotmaps Premium products are included. See the "HD" column of the Complete lake list. (Existing NavPlanner2 users may update their lake maps to 2011 content for free.)

    What about Canadian charts or lakes?
    Navionics NavPlanner2 does not contain any Canadian navigation chart or lake map data. Canadian charts and lakes purchased on Navionics Plug-and-Play chips (after April 2010) may be viewed in NavPlanner2 via the included Generic Multi Card Reader.

    What about Canada/US bordering lakes?
    Lakes straddling the US/Canada border will be shown in full detail on the US side only. The Canadian side of such lakes are not included. Canadian charts and lakes purchased on Navionics Plug-and-Play chips (after April 2010) may be viewed in NavPlanner2 via the included Generic Multi Card Reader.

    What about Navionics charts for the rest of the world?
    Navionics charts purchased on Navionics Plug-and-Play chips after April 2010 may be viewed in NavPlanner2 via the included Generic Multi Card Reader. Navionics NavPlanner2 supports Navionics Silver, Gold, Platinum and Platinum+ format charts.
    Can the included charts and lake map be uploaded to a GPS receiver or chart plotter?
    No. The included charts and lake maps are for use only with the included PC software. With Navionics NavPlanner2 software one can use the included charts and lake maps to plan a coastal cruise or inland fishing trip on the PC, print paper copies of maps, and create waypoints and routes. Only waypoints and routes may be transferred to and from a GPS receiver or chart plotter. For a list of supported GPS and chart plotter devices, click here.

    Can I connect a GPS directly to my PC or laptop and view my position in "real-time" using Navionics NavPlanner2?
    No. Navionics NavPlanner2 is strictly for map viewing, printing and waypoint creation for upload to a GPS or chart plotter. In other words, Navionics NavPlanner2 is a powerful planning tool for all on water activities.

    Can the included charts and maps be used in Fugawi Marine ENC for "real-time" navigation?
    No. To use Navionics charts within Fugawi Marine ENC, you must purchase the charts on a
    Navionics Plug-and-Play chip.
    How can I transfer waypoints to my iPhone?
    You can transfer waypoints from Navionics NavPlanner2 to the iNavX App for iPhone or the Fugawi iMap application for iPhone if you subscribe to Fugawi X-Traverse.
